The intermediate layer 220 includes an emission layer 222 on the pixel electrode 210 exposed through the opening of the pixel-defining film 2190. The emission layer 222 may include a high molecular weight organic material or a low molecular weight organic material that emits light of a predetermined color. The first functional layer 221 may have a single or multi-layer structure. For example, when the first functional layer 221 is formed of a high molecular weight material, the first functional layer 221 that is a hole transport layer (HTL) having a single-layer structure may be formed of poly(3,4-ethylenedioxythiophene) (PEDOT) or polyaniline (PANI). When the first functional layer 221 is formed of a low molecular weight material, the first functional layer 221 may include a hole injection layer (HIL) and a hole transport layer (HTL).
The second functional layer 223 is optional. For example, when each of the first functional layer 221 and the emission layer 222 is formed of a high molecular weight material, in order to improve the characteristics of the OLED, it is preferable to form the second functional layer 223. The second functional layer 223 may have a single or multi-layer structure. The second functional layer 223 may include an electron transport layer (ETL) and/or an electron injection layer (EIL).
